MOSCOW, September 16 - RIA Novosti. State Duma deputies from the New People faction proposed fixing tax rules for five years, and introducing new taxes no earlier than two years later.

RIA Novosti has a corresponding appeal addressed to Russian Prime Minister Mikhail Mishustin.

“It seems appropriate to supplement Article 5 of the Tax Code of the Russian Federation with a special rule for five-year stability of key tax parameters... Separately, it seems appropriate to increase the minimum transition period for newly established federal taxes and fees. It is proposed to introduce such mandatory payments no earlier than 24 months from the date of official publication of the relevant federal law,” the document says.

The deputies added that, according to the proposed changes, if federal law establishes or changes a tax rate, a key limit for the application of a special tax regime or tax exemption, or the basic rules for determining the tax base, a subsequent change in the corresponding parameter towards an increase in the tax burden, as a general rule, could come into force no earlier than five years from the date of entry into force of the previous change.

“Such a restriction should not prevent changes that improve the situation of taxpayers, including lowering rates and increasing maximum values. It should also not apply to the end of temporary measures, the validity period of which was established immediately when they were introduced,” the document clarifies.
